Just had a look under the d 40 was going to measure up for some bash plates. Noticed some gunk on the underside of the exhaust ,looked above and can see some fresh oil leaking out of the transfer case / gear box. Car is almost up for 50 K service. Is this a worry ?
 
Thanks for the replies. Murphy's law says the leak will drop straight on the exhaust !!
 
Nissan looked at leaking seal. Found the diff seal was also leaking. Fixed both under warranty , Stung me for $178 for the oil !! Tried arguing with them that the seal let the water in. No it is impossible for that to happen must have been driven through a large puddle enough to submerge the breather hose. Still arguing with Nissan Aust , no one hold your breath .:deadhorse:
 
pinion seal and rear transfer case replaced outside of warranty cost me $350. also said it had drawn in muddy water???. not in the 85k since i've owned it
 
Email back from Nissan dealer states that even the new seals will let water in if not cooled before driving through puddle or creek. Seal is to keep oil in not water out ?? WTF . He suggests waiting 10 mins to allow seals to cool before being submerged. He even asked his mechanic. ??? :chainsaw:
